Multi-Cloud Strategy: Benefits, Challenges and Threats
Modern enterprises are increasingly opting for a multi-cloud technique. Quite a few firms by now began using a multiple-cloud strategy because it offers them extra flexibility and makes it possible for them to innovate and deploy speedier. This is specially accurate in mild of the increasing reputation of Application as a Services (SaaS) in companies.
Sourcing from many clouds is becoming much more beneficial and delivers enterprises with a aggressive gain. Nonetheless, adopting a multi-cloud method poses new integration troubles for corporations. Discover about both equally sides.
What Is A Multi-Cloud Technique?
In new yrs, the cloud has been buzzing with innovations. Somewhat than sticking to one particular system and lacking out on the advantages, a multi-cloud technique allows you to combine the greatest pieces of just one or additional cloud computing products and services from any other cloud computing service number providers. Dependent on the features and companies you want to give, you can use a combine of non-public and community cloud strategies.
When an particular person or organization employs far more than just one cloud provider for their IT needs, this is acknowledged as multi-cloud. This strategy permits companies to much better aid their organization, technologies, and assistance dependability demands even though keeping away from over-reliance on a one cloud supplier that might not be able of completing all jobs.
A multi-cloud method can include things like private, general public, and hybrid clouds, making it possible for providers to control several suppliers and virtual infrastructure effectiveness a lot more competently. The multi-cloud architecture lets for the distribution of cloud programs, belongings, and software package across multiple environments, which include Infrastructure-as-a-Assistance (IaaS), Platform-as-a-Provider (PaaS), and Software program-as-a-Service (SaaS) alternatives.
Escalating Adoption Of Multi-Cloud Method
Around the very last few a long time, multi-cloud has grow to be a buzzword in the engineering business. Some investigation implies that 81 p.c of organizations are thinking about or actively pursuing a multi-cloud system.
Each and every organization has its have business and technical motivations for adopting a multi-cloud approach, and they are customizing solutions to fulfill their distinctive demands. Multi-cloud permits enterprises to deliver expert services across personal and public clouds, enabling them to host workloads in the most appropriate place though retaining a constant protection method.
Pros and Downsides of a Multi-Cloud Strategy
Businesses inclined to adopt cloud infrastructure should be aware of the added benefits and worries of integrating a multi-cloud approach:
The subsequent are the set of added benefits and troubles of adopting a multi-cloud approach:
Gains Of Multi-Cloud Strategy
Some of the key rewards of a multi-cloud strategy include things like:
The versatility to innovate immediately while taking edge of the exceptional or most effective-in-class solutions that every single cloud provider provides is the key gain of a multi-cloud approach. This lets your builders to focus on innovation rather than compromising to satisfy the constraints of one particular cloud provider around a further.
It’s similar to the regular business approach, in which the vendor dictates the architecture of enterprise apps by means of functions. The capability to innovate by combining the right set of expert services is the most sizeable benefit of a multi-cloud strategy.
Though all cloud vendors compete to deliver the very best products and services and toolsets for every little thing you require, a multi-cloud method lets you to choose the company and companies that ideal go well with your desires.
- Managing Vendor Lock-in
Working with several cloud providers cuts down your reliance on a one cloud supplier.
It is unsafe to depend on a one services service provider for every thing. A single service provider could not be in a position to meet the support stage needs for a supplied support. A cloud company could go out of business enterprise or turn into a competitor.
When outages are exceptional, they do come about and can bring about significant disruption. By not placing all of your eggs in a single basket, a multi-cloud strategy can enable you stay clear of big IT disasters.To host your surroundings, all cloud vendors have a number of geographic regions and info centres within each area.
Going multi-cloud permits you to have a independent, impartial duplicate of your application managing on an additional cloud provider’s infrastructure, which you can deploy if a single seller goes down.
You can decide on cloud areas and zones close to your prospects to decrease latency and enhance consumer experience. The quicker your application responds, the shorter the distance facts ought to journey.
Inspite of the actuality that just about every cloud service provider has data centres all around the planet, one particular supplier may perhaps be nearer to your customers than the other individuals. Using a combination of cloud companies to accomplish a lot quicker speeds may be worthy of it to enhance the user working experience of your programs.
Issues Of Adopting Multi-Cloud Strategy
Building and managing a multi-cloud architecture has its individual established of problems. Some of the key problems of implementing a multi-cloud tactic incorporate:
- Cost Estimation, Optimization & Reporting
Despite the fact that using numerous cloud distributors can help save dollars, consolidating fees, chargeback, and price estimation will become a lot more intricate. Every cloud provider rates otherwise for every services, so you will will need to fully grasp just about every cloud’s pricing composition to wade by way of the math and draught estimates.
To competently control the money elements of making use of products and services across numerous clouds in terms of use and billing, Cross-account value reporting and optimization applications are essential. When transferring knowledge involving clouds, expenses may perhaps be better in some instances thanks to the greater charges of transferring facts from a single cloud to one more.
Experts in the cloud are in significant desire. Acquiring developers, engineers, and safety authorities who are acquainted with many clouds is almost unachievable. Cloud engineers and architects with abilities in a one cloud company are difficult to find.
To acquire on multiple cloud platforms, safe multiple infrastructures, and regulate and run numerous clouds as an organisation, you are going to require to employ the service of the ideal individuals.
Functioning with a solitary cloud service provider allows you to get gain of their resources and abilities to control your app’s knowledge stability, accessibility permissions, and compliance necessities.
When apps are dispersed across various clouds, they grow to be far more complicated and have a bigger attack area, which improves the chance of a stability breach. Setting up a protected network for a one cloud with IDS/IPS, firewalls, WAF, virus security, and incident reaction is difficult.
Throughout numerous clouds, companies need to consider how they will configure, take care of, inform, log, and react to stability situations.
Whilst the cloud revolution progresses and knowledge volumes mature, organizations proceed to count on out-of-date protection techniques this kind of as passwords, putting their numerous environments, remote workers, and various apps at danger.
Conclusion
As organizations grow and increase new applications and providers to their IT environments, multi-cloud administration gets more and more crucial. Making use of several cloud vendors can significantly advantage firms. You can decrease your reliance on a solitary supplier, cherry-pick the very best companies, make your application a lot quicker and more resilient, and probably decrease costs.
However, your company’s IT philosophy and maturity and your ability to make it perform will impact your decision to go to a multi-cloud ecosystem. You need to weigh the added benefits and disadvantages and commit to effectively architect, govern, and execute in a multi-cloud natural environment.